Solar tower power plants consist of several hundred to several thousand mirrors, so-called heliostats, which focus solar radiation upon a collector tower. An important step in the qualification of solar tower power plants is the monitoring of the heliostats. Operationally relevant parameters include their alignment and the condition of the mirror panels. To reduce the cost of qualification and automate the monitoring, unmanned aerial vehicles (UAVs) are increasingly being used. These capture aerial images, which are then evaluated by image-processing algorithms. Although conventional image-processing methods already achieve good results, they often still require manual intervention. For this reason, the use of deep learning methods is currently being investigated at our institute.
